Fire TV Stick 4K vs Roku Streaming Stick 4K: Which Should You Buy in 2026

Both of these cost about the same, both stream in 4K, and both disappear behind your TV. So picking one really comes down to whose menus you can stand and which voice assistant already lives in your house. Ive bounced between the two on the same set for a while, and they split along pretty predictable lines.

If youre already deep in the Amazon world, the Fire Stick fits right in. If you want a remote thats simple and a home screen that isnt constantly selling you something, Roku pulls ahead. We rounded up the wider field in the Roku alternatives roundup if neither one clicks for you.

FeatureFire TV Stick 4KRoku Streaming Stick 4K
Home screenAmazon content up frontApp-neutral, your apps
Ads on the menuA lotFewer, less pushy
Voice assistantAlexa, full featuredRoku voice, basic but fine
RemoteGood, Alexa buttonDead simple, shortcut keys
Free stuffAmazon Freevee built inThe Roku Channel
Price~$50~$50

Fire TV Stick 4K, Pros & Cons

What We Liked

  • Alexa actually does a lot here, not just play and pause
  • If you watch Prime Video, everything is one tap away
  • Snappy enough, no real lag jumping between apps

Worth Knowing

  • The home screen is basically an Amazon billboard
  • Finding a non-Amazon app takes more scrolling than it should

Roku Streaming Stick 4K, Pros & Cons

What We Liked

  • The menu doesnt play favorites, every app sits side by side
  • Remote is the easiest one in the house to hand to a guest
  • The Roku Channel has a surprising amount of free stuff
  • Setup took maybe five minutes

Worth Knowing

  • Voice search is more limited than Alexa
  • It still shows you some ads, just gentler ones

Which Should You Get?

Heres the quick version. Own an Echo, watch a ton of Prime Video, dont mind Amazon being everywhere? Get the Fire Stick, it folds into that setup nicely. Want something your whole family can use without a tutorial, and a screen that isnt nagging you? Roku, every time.

For what its worth, when friends ask me which to buy and they dont have a strong opinion, I tell them Roku. Its just the one fewer people complain about a month later.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need a subscription to use either one?

No. The stick itself is a one-time buy. You only pay for the streaming services you choose, and both have free channels built in if you dont want to pay for anything.

Which one has a better picture?

Theyre a wash. Both do 4K HDR and youd be hard pressed to tell them apart on the same TV. Picture quality shouldnt be your deciding factor here.

Will all my apps work on both?

Pretty much. Netflix, Disney+, Max, YouTube, Hulu, all the big ones run on both. The only real gap is Amazon stuff feels more at home on the Fire Stick.

The Bottom Line

Same price, same picture, different vibe. The Fire TV Stick 4K rewards you for living in Amazons world. The Roku Streaming Stick 4K just gets out of your way, which is why its the one Id hand most people. Pick based on which annoyance you can live with, not the specs.
